We know Goethe's phrase:
"The secret of our disease is to oscillate between haste and neglect"
.
It is these two criticisms that the elected officials and restaurateurs in Marseille have been addressing to the government for a few days.
Haste in decision-making, despite the promise embodied by the Prime Minister of better coordination with local elected officials;
and neglect at least on form, because the brutality with which the new coercive measures were adopted surprised many French people on Wednesday evening.
FigaroVox opened its columns to Doctor
Antoine Flahault
, who supports these measures by reminding us of the urgency of the situation: the concern about the renewed intensity of the epidemic is well founded, and there is no time to waste , underlines this specialist.
Nevertheless, answers essayist
Édouard Tetreau
, it is a disaster for our entrepreneurs and for employment, which could have been avoided, he judges.
